Collaboration Tools
for Remote Web Development Teams
Collaboration Tools for Remote Web Development Teams
In today’s digital age, remote work has become increasingly popular among web development teams. The ability to work from anywhere, at any time, has its advantages, but it also presents unique challenges. One of the most significant challenges is collaboration. How can a team of web developers, who may be spread across the globe, effectively collaborate on projects? The answer lies in the use of collaboration tools. In this blog post, we will explore some of the most effective collaboration tools for remote web development teams.
1. Version Control Systems
Version control systems, such as Git and GitHub, are essential tools for any web development team. These systems allow team members to work on the same project simultaneously, while keeping track of every change made to the code. This ensures that everyone is working with the most up-to-date version of the project and helps to prevent conflicts and errors.
2. Communication Platforms
Effective communication is crucial for remote teams. There are numerous communication platforms available, such as Slack and Microsoft Teams, which allow team members to communicate in real-time. These platforms also provide features like file sharing, video conferencing, and task management, making it easier for team members to collaborate and stay organized. 3. Project Management Tools
Project management tools, such as Trello and Asana, help to streamline the project management process. These tools allow team members to create and assign tasks, set deadlines, and track progress. They also provide a centralized location for team members to discuss project-related matters and share important documents.
4. Code Review Tools
Code review tools, such as GitHub and Bitbucket, enable team members to review and provide feedback on each other’s code. This process helps to ensure that the code is of high quality and adheres to the team’s coding standards. It also provides an opportunity for team members to learn from one another and improve their skills.
5. Screen Sharing and Remote Desktop Tools
Screen sharing and remote desktop tools, such as Zoom and TeamViewer, are invaluable for remote web development teams. These tools allow team members to share their screens with others, making it easier to demonstrate or troubleshoot issues. They also enable team members to access and work on the same computer remotely, which can be particularly useful for debugging or resolving technical issues.
6. Virtual Meeting Platforms
Virtual meeting platforms, such as Zoom and Google Meet, provide a space for team members to communicate face-to-face, even when they are located in different parts of the world. These platforms also allow team members to share their screens and collaborate on documents in real-time, making it easier to conduct meetings and discuss project-related matters. In conclusion, collaboration tools play a vital role in the success of remote web development teams. By utilizing these tools, teams can effectively collaborate on projects, communicate with one another, and ensure that everyone is working towards a common goal. As the world becomes increasingly digital, the importance of these tools will only continue to grow.